How Our Team Handles Commercial Water Damage Restoration
Our team’s process for commercial water damage restoration is designed to be efficient, effective, and stress-free. We understand that every minute counts when dealing with water damage, which is why we’ve developed a step-by-step approach to ensure your property is restored to its original condition.
Step 1: Emergency Response
When you call us, our team will dispatch a technician to your location within 60 minutes to assess the situation and provide a detailed estimate. Our technician will identify the source of the water, find out the extent of the damage, and recommend the best course of action.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using our state-of-the-art equipment, our technician will extract as much water as possible from your property to prevent further damage and reduce drying time. This includes using powerful pumps and wet/dry vacuums to remove standing water and saturated materials.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Our technician will set up industrial-grade drying equipment, such as air movers and dehumidifiers, to dry your property thoroughly. This includes drying walls, floors, ceilings, and any other affected areas to prevent mold growth and further damage.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Cleaning
Once your property is dry, our technician will sanitize and clean all affected areas to remove any remaining moisture, bacteria, and other contaminants. This includes using specialized cleaning solutions and equipment to ensure your property is safe and healthy.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Certification
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ure your property is completely dry and free of any remaining issues. We’ll also provide a certification of completion, which includes a detailed report of the work done and any recommendations for future maintenance.

Warning Signs You Need Commercial Water Damage Restoration
Catching water damage early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ent costly downtime. Be on the lookout for these warning signs: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a persistent, unpleasant odor in your property, it could be a sign of water damage or mold growth. Don’t ignore it, call our team to investigate and address the issue before it becomes a bigger problem.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Water damage can cause your flooring to warp or buckle, which can lead to further damage and safety hazards. If you notice any unusual changes in your flooring, call our team to inspect and repair it.
Stains on Walls or Ceilings
Water stains on your walls or ceilings can be a sign of water damage or leaks. Don’t ignore them, call our team to inspect and repair the issue before it becomes a bigger problem.
Unusual Sounds or Leaks
Unusual sounds, such as dripping or gurgling, or visible leaks can be a sign of water damage. Don’t wait, call our team to investigate and address the issue before it becomes a bigger problem.
Mold or Mildew Growth
Mold or mildew growth can be a sign of water damage or poor ventilation. Don’t ignore it, call our team to inspect and remediate the issue before it becomes a bigger problem.

Common Questions About Commercial Water Damage Restoration
Q: What causes water damage in commercial properties?
A: Water damage can be caused by a variety of factors, including heavy rainfall, burst pipes, overflowing sinks, and appliance malfunctions. It’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age and costly repairs.
Q: How long does commercial water damage restoration take?
A: The length of time required for commercial water damage restoration depends on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the type of equipment used. Our team will work diligently to complete the job as quickly as possible, usually within 3-5 days.
Q: Is commercial water damage restoration covered by insurance?
A: Yes, commercial water damage restoration is typically covered by insurance, but the specifics depend on your policy and the circumstances of the damage. We’ll work with your insurance provider to ensure you receive the coverage you deserve.
Q: Can I prevent water damage in my commercial property?
A: Yes, there are several steps you can take to prevent water damage in your commercial property, including regular maintenance, inspecting your plumbing and appliances, and installing a sump pump or backup power source. We’ll be happy to provide more information and recommendations.
